The Vietnamese-Chinese-English wall menu styles this dish "banh bot chien cu cai" but helpfully notes that the featured ingredient is fried daikon — also the star of Singaporean "carrot cake." This very eggy version ($5) may be typically Vietnamese-Chinese or simply a quiddity of Ba-Le; I can't say.
